[Diabetes had its symptoms described 3000 years ago](https://www.medicalnewstoday.com/articles/317484#early-science)
"Over 3,000 years ago, the ancient Egyptians mentioned a condition that appears to have been type 1 diabetes. It featured excessive urination, thirst, and weight loss.
The writers recommended following a diet of whole grains to reduce the symptoms.
In ancient India, people discovered that they could use ants to test for diabetes by presenting urine to them. If the ants came to the urine, this was a sign that it contained high sugar levels. They called the condition madhumeha, meaning honey urine"
Diabetes wasn't named diabetes back then, but it was already discovered, described and treated.
